## Release Checklist — LockerLink v3.1

- Verify laundry-locker access flow: QR grant expires after 10 minutes, single use.
- Confirm revocation propagates to all kiosks within 30 seconds.
- Audit log entries immutable; no PII in payloads.
- Pen-test report attached and signed off.

Reviewer must confirm the artifact matches the token below.

build token for fawef-hahof: htk4_4b15

Subject: Partner SFTP drop — new owner

Hi,

As you review the pending changes to the Harborline ingest scripts, note that ownership of the partner SFTP drop is changing at the end of the month. This includes key rotation, the nightly pull job, and the quarantine folder for malformed files. Review comments on the retry logic should still go through the normal PR flow, but questions about drop-folder conventions or partner onboarding now go to the new owner. The incoming owner is listed below.

signatory, tagaf-bahaf: Praael Fenmir Rusok

Briefing: Renewal of Ostrander Fabrics Supply Contract

For the finance team, leadership review prep. Current three-year agreement with Ostrander Fabrics expires in Q1. Proposed renewal: two years, 4% price increase, volume rebate above 80k units. Alternative bid from Wrenhall Mills is 6% cheaper but unproven on lead times. Recommendation: renew Ostrander, pilot Wrenhall on secondary lines. Hold all terms in confidence pending signature. Strategic context appears in the confidential note below.

board note of kageg-bahof: The renewal with Holwynax Holdings closes at $2 million a year, 5 percent below the last contract. Project Ulaath slips by two quarters because of the supplier delay.

Welcome to on-call for the Glimmerpane design system! Our snapshot tests live in the `snapcheck` suite and run on every merge to main. If a UI component changes visually, the diff bot flags it — usually it's an intentional tweak, so just approve the new baseline. If it's 2am and snapshots are failing across the board, it's almost always a font-loading race, not your problem. To unlock the baseline store and re-approve snapshots in bulk, use the recovery passphrase below.

recovery phrase for tahag-taguf: wenix-caswyn